Brief summary
This study is being done to investigate clonal hematopoiesis and therapy-emergent myeloid neoplasms in patients with ovarian or other solid cancers. Researchers want to identify risk factors for developing these blood cancers as well as if there is/are a genetic/environmental component(s) to developing blood cancer.
Detailed description
OUTLINE: This is an observational study. Patients undergo blood sample collection and complete surveys on study. Patients' medical records are also reviewed.

Eligibility
Inclusion criteria
* Subjects who have or have had ovarian, peritoneal, or fallopian tube carcinoma who have a life expectancy of greater than 6 months and: * Have completed or plan to complete at least 5 cycles of platinum-based chemotherapy OR * Subjects who have or have had a solid tumor diagnosis and any of the following: * At least 4 months of exposure to a PARP inhibitor * Diagnosis of a blood disorder including, but not limited to, clonal hematopoiesis of indeterminate potential, cytopenia of unknown significance, or therapy-related myeloid neoplasm
Exclusion criteria
* Individuals with a life expectancy of less than 6 months
Design outcomes
Primary
| Measure | Time frame | Description |
|---|---|---|
| Determine the correlation between baseline TP53m VAF in blood with CH expansion in OC patients | Through study completion, up to 5 years | — |
| Identify risk of TMN for OC survivors with and without TP53m CH treated with platinum chemotherapy and PARP inhibitors | Through study completion, up to 5 years | Measurement Tool: will measure by BM biopsy confirmation done by local hematologist |
| Define the trajectories of clonal evolution and mechanisms of transformation from non-cancerous TP53m to TMN | Through study completion, up to 5 years | Measurement Tool: the variant allele fraction of the blood clone |
